If you’re baking many consecutive pizzas, you should also re-heat the pizza stone between every 2 pizzas. The temperature of the stone will drop when you add a cold (room temperature) pizza, and will therefore not be hot enough to make more than 2 crispy pizzas right after each other. ctbc bank promotion
